		</p><p><strong>Dear Ask the Stylist</strong></p>
<p><strong>I’d love to wear a “different” hat to the races this Christmas. Can you suggest anything?</strong></p>
<p>Trilby hats are a great look for winter racing.</p>
<p>Make like Sonya Lennon (pictured) who is one of the judges at this year’s Most Stylish Lady competition at <a href="http://www.whatshewears.ie/most-stylish-lady-competition-on-lexus-chase-day-at-the-leopardstown-christmas-festival-2011-281211/">Leopardstown Christmas racing</a>, with her bright trilby and cape combination.</p>
<p>Sonya&#8217;s chapeau of choice is <a href="http://www.designcentre.ie/?cat=14">Philip Treacy</a> at <a href="http://www.designcentre.ie/">The Design Centre, Powerscourt</a> and you&#8217;ll also find some amazing trilby hats by Martha Lynn at <a href="http://project51.ie/">Project 51</a>  &#8211; pictured is one of Martha&#8217;s designs in purple (€275) which also comes in navy.</p>
<p>On the high street, we love the selection of trilbies at Aso, the nude one pictured is €28.25 at <a href="http://www.asos.com/Catarzi/Catarzi-Exclusive-For-Asos-Wide-Front-Fedora-Hat/Prod/pgeproduct.aspx?iid=1744418&amp;SearchQuery=trilby&amp;sh=0&amp;pge=0&amp;pgesize=20&amp;sort=-1&amp;clr=Icebeige">ASOS </a>  while over at <a href="http://www.topshop.com/webapp/wcs/stores/servlet/ProductDisplay?beginIndex=0&amp;viewAllFlag=&amp;catalogId=33057&amp;storeId=12556&amp;productId=3190251&amp;langId=-1&amp;categoryId=&amp;searchTerm=hat&amp;pageSize=20">Topshop</a> (£28) we found them in teal and in purple. <a href="http://www.asos.com/Catarzi/Catarzi-Exclusive-For-Asos-Wide-Front-Fedora-Hat/Prod/pgeproduct.aspx?iid=1744418&amp;SearchQuery=trilby&amp;sh=0&amp;pge=0&amp;pgesize=20&amp;sort=-1&amp;clr=Icebeige"><br />
</a></p>
<p>Wear over a jumpsuit, seperates or dress and accessorise with a pair of long leather gloves by<a href="http://www.glovesbypaularowan.ie/buygloves/silk-lined/sienna"> Paula Rowan</a>, (from €148.72), some <a href="http://www.reissonline.com/eu/shop/womens/coats_and_jackets/fur/feather/mist/ ">faux fur</a> and a stand out <a href="http://www.reissonline.com/eu/shop/womens/bags/clutch_bags/comet/magenta/ ">clutch</a>.</p>

		</p><p>Jennifer Rothwell is one of 15 designers involved in an exciting new Irish Designer Collective store, Project 51 on South William St Dublin 2 which opened this week.</p>
<p>Rothwell&#8217;s AW 11 collection (an amazing array of jersey dresses &amp; jumpsuits and <em>Trevi fountain</em> print silk dresses &amp; coats) will be available exclusively at this location where she’ll also be running courses for starting your own <strong>Fashion Label and Manufacturing Courses</strong> this September.</p>
<p>Project 51 &#8211; The Irish Design Collective, is a high end NYC Soho style luxury boutique filled with the best of Irish fashion, jewellery, millinery, accessories and furniture. It offers the ultimate shopping experience in a relaxed friendly atmosphere. Customers can choose from an amazing selection of luxury goods, from engagement rings to bridal wear, jewellery, evening wear, tailoring, millinery and luxury leather bags.</p>
<p>Project 51 is headed up by Eoin McDonnell owner of Precious, diamond and wedding rings specialist who tells us that ‘ For every €100 spent in a multinational store only €14 goes back into the local economy versus €45 through an Irish owned shop, thus by customers buying from Project 51 there is more money going back into the Irish economy&#8217; ”.</p>
<p><strong>Project 51 is strictly Irish designers who are based in Ireland and includes the following designers:</strong></p>
<p>Ana Faye (Leather Bags)<br />
Caiomhe Keane &#8211; Que-Va.com (Fashion)<br />
Colette Van Jaar &#8211; Arcology.ie (Architect – sustainable furniture)<br />
Claire O Connor    (Fashion)<br />
Eily O Connell  (Jewellery)<br />
Emma Taylor &#8211; RubyJewels.ie (Jewellery)<br />
Eoin McDonnell &#8211; Precious.ie (Jewellery)<br />
Geraldine Murphy &#8211; Saba.ie (Jewellery)<br />
Heather Finn (Fashion)<br />
Jennifer Rothwell (Fashion)<br />
Martha Lynn (Millinery)<br />
Sinead Doyle (Fashion)<br />
Sinead Clarke &#8211; EssenC.ie (Fashion)<br />
Vikki Shorten &#8211; VSLJewelry.com (Jewellery)<br />
Yvonne Ryan &#8211; EveElla.com (Jewellery)</p>
<p>Two of the designers have even created gear for <strong>Lady Gaga</strong> (VSL cuffs ) and <strong>Michelle Obama</strong> (Claire O&#8217;Connor).</p>

		</p><p><strong>Dear  Ask the Stylist</strong></p>
<p><strong>I’m heading to the races this weekend for ladies Day at Leopardstown, judged by Philip Tracey (I guess a hat is a must then!).  What does one wear to a winter race meeting to look glam and still stay warm? Thanks !</strong></p>
<p>With the racing season kicking off this weekend at the <a title="hennessy gold cup" href="http://www.whatshewears.ie/hennessy-gold-cup/" target="_blank">Hennessy Gold Cup</a> (where <em>Jasmine Guinness and Philip Treacy</em> will be judging the Best Dressed Lady competition) we get in the mood with some racing outfit inspiration.</p>
<p>For this Ask the Stylist query, we turned to Martha Lynn for her expertise. Martha has won quite a few Ladies Day competitions herself, even at <a title="leopardstown races" href="http://www.whatshewears.ie/index.php/2009/12/best-dressed-lady-leopardstown-races/" target="_blank">Leopardstown Races</a> where the Hennessey Gold Cup takes place this Sunday.  She also happens to be a milliner (hat maker) and works out of her studio in Dublin, see <a href="http://www.marthalynnmillinery.com/">www.marthalynnmillinery.com </a> and is pictured above in the <a title="red coat races" href="http://www.whatshewears.ie/best-dressed-lady-leopardstown-races/" target="_blank">red coat and hat.</a></p>
<p>Martha says:</p>
<p>Fur is really in at the moment and I picked up a lovely vintage one in London last year so I&#8217;m hoping to wear it to the next race meeting.</p>
<p>You can&#8217;t argue with fur when it comes to keeping you warm.</p>
<p>I know not everyone is a fur fan, so some good <a title="thermals" href="http://www.whatshewears.ie/cold-weather-gear/ " target="_blank">thermals</a> will do the job and not interfere with your glamorous outfit!!</p>

<p><strong>I got as a gift an animal print dress and matching shoes from Karen Millen.  I have been trying to match a head piece/bag/umbrella to it as I would like a nice outfit for the racing season. Any tips? S.</strong></p>
<p><em>For this Ask the Stylist query, we turned to Martha Lynn for her expertise. Martha has won quite a few Ladies Day competitions herself, most recently at <a title="leopardstown races" href="http://www.whatshewears.ie/index.php/2009/12/best-dressed-lady-leopardstown-races/" target="_blank">Leopardstown Races</a>. She also happens to be a milliner (hat maker) and works out of her studio in Dublin.</em></p>
<p>The dress and shoes are amazing. Animal prints are very popular this season.</p>
<p>As the dress and shoes are matching I would probably go for some <strong>neutral accessories</strong> ie nothing too busy, to bring the outfit together.</p>
<p>I would suggest focusing in on either the <strong>black</strong> or the <strong>beige </strong>colours in the animal print. This also means that you will be able to wear your headpiece and accessories with a variety of different outfits.</p>
<p>I would also recommend going for a <strong>simple headpiece</strong> to compliment the pattern on the dress and shoes, as the pattern on the dress and shoes in themselves are the showpiece.</p>
<p>It would of course be ideal to get your hat or headpiece made to order to compliment your individual style, but if that was not an option there are a great variety of headpieces and fascinators available from some of the high street shops, like Accessorize and Marks and Spencers.</p>
<p>Avoca do a range of coloured umbrellas and occasionally have matching gloves.</p>

<p><strong>About Martha Lynn</strong></p>
<p>Martha Lynn is a young and passionate milliner based in Dublin, whose handmade creations fuse the traditional elements of millinery with a modern edge. From refined to ethereal, Martha combines the fashion mood of the moment with the wearer’s own style and personality to create pieces that are perfectly crafted, stunning and unique.</p>
<p>Spending countless hours of her childhood in her mother’s studio in Roscommon, Martha discovered her love for art at an early age and went on to complete a degree in Fine Art, specialising in sculpture at the Dun Laoghaire Institute of Art, Design and Technology. Following her graduation, Martha worked as a 3D visual artist for a leading architectural and design company in Dublin but realised her passion for millinery after studying under renowned Milliner, Ms. Aileen Keogan, at the Grafton Academy in Dublin, a fantastic teacher and an inspiration.</p>
<p>Now, in May 2010, Martha has just returned from doing an internship with both Philip Treacy and Stephen Jones in London. During her time there she worked on hats for both Valentino and Galliano for fashion week.</p>

		</p><p>There was a predominant red theme amongst the finalists of the best dressed lady competition today at Leopardstown race course (see group photo above), with red and black being an ideal colour combination for around Christmas time.</p>
<p>In fact, it’s very tricky to be a stylish best dressed lady and keep warm at the same time but Martha Lynn from Roscommon (living in Donnybrook) knew how to do just that and won the Irish Tatler and Fran &amp; Jane Most Stylish Lady Competition today at Lexus Chase Day at the Leopardstown Christmas Festival (Bank Holiday Monday 28 December).</p>
<h2>What The Best Dressed Lady Wore</h2>
<p>The Best Dressed Lady or  Most Stylish Lady as it&#8217;s known here, wore a <strong>black and red headpiece she made herself, a coat from Penneys that she had dyed red, a H&amp;M dress, Wolford tights and red shoes from Zerep</strong> – proof that you can still look stunning on a budget and by reinventing your outerwear!</p>
<p>There was a fabulous turnout of beautiful and stylish women at the races including Lorraine Keane, Faith Amond, and finalists in the competition Jane Mulrooney from Galway and Catherine London from Mullingar. Sir Alex Ferguson was also in the crowd.</p>
<h2>The Prize</h2>
<p>Irish Tatler gave Martha Lynn the winner of the Most Stylish Lady Competition a 5 page photo shoot to be published in Irish Tatler&#8217;s April issue. Martha also bagged a €2,000 voucher to spend in Fran &amp; Jane boutiques. Andrea Roche was joined by fellow judges Jessie Collins, the new editor of Irish Tatler and Laura Nolan from Fran &amp; Jane boutiques.</p>
<p>Andrea Roche, Top Irish Model &amp; Irish Tatler and Fran &amp; Jane Ladies Day Judge said: &#8211; “There was an incredible array of gorgeous women at the races today, oodles of style and it was great to see people dressed for the weather and enjoying themselves as, while the sun is shining,  its fairly icy out there!</p>
<p>We had a hard job narrowing it down to 10 finalists as there was so many to choose from. Our delighted winner Martha Lynn went away with a €2,000 voucher for Fran &amp; Jane which is a great way to sort out her New Year wardrobe and we&#8217;ll be seeing our winner in Irish Tatler next March which was a fantastic and unique prize.&#8221;</p>
<h2>Proven track record for style</h2>
<p>At WhatSheWears.ie, we’ve seen the winner dress in style before back at The Irish Derby in April (when she also looked stunning in red) – see our pictures <a title="Irish Derby Best Dressed entrant" href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/whatshewears/3670987513/in/set-72157620718783864/ " target="_self">here</a>.</p>
<p>She also won the G Hotel <strong>best hat competition</strong> at the Galway Races when she won a bespoke <strong>Philip Treacy</strong> designed hat, quite like the one SJP wore to the SATC premiere. Catch the picture of her <a title="G Hotel best hat competition winner" href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/whatshewears/sets/72157623087837720/ " target="_self">here</a>.</p>
<p>Martha Lynn, Winner of the Best Dressed Lady said: &#8211; “I’m so delighted and excited to have won today, it’s pretty amazing as I go racing all around Ireland from Kilbeggan to the Curragh… I can’t wait for the Irish Tatler photo shoot although it’s a little daunting and I’ll have a blast spending the Fran &amp; Jane voucher – something to really look forward to going into 2010.”</p>
<p>Race Day style must run in the family, as her sister, Louise Lynn won best dressed lady at <a title="Best dressed leopardstown 2008" href="http://www.independent.ie/national-news/recession-chic-romps-home-in-bestdressed-fashion-stakes-1587126.html" target="_self">last years</a> Leopardstown Christmas festival.</p>
